Paweł Chudzik 5/7/2020

Synchronous communication - circuit breaker and fallback

Read Original

This technical article explains the circuit breaker pattern for synchronous communication in software systems, a design pattern that prevents cascading failures. It draws an analogy to electrical circuit breakers, describes the open, closed, and half-open states, and discusses the importance of fallback values. The article then provides a practical, code-based examination of implementing circuit breakers using the Hystrix and Resilience4j libraries in a controlled test scenario.

Synchronous communication - circuit breaker and fallback

Comments

No comments yet

Be the first to share your thoughts!

Browser Extension

Get instant access to AllDevBlogs from your browser

Top of the Week